Transaction 2dd33a91749c83187f770b66d9ee1df67880bb1e48ee2b91d803b08f162cefee

1 Input
2 Outputs
  • 2dd33a91749c83187f770b66d9ee1df67880bb1e48ee2b91d803b08f162cefee:0
  • value  5209477
    address  3MT6GY2tsGTDQBEH1cDEPp3WPEKRBvi8Wf
  • 2dd33a91749c83187f770b66d9ee1df67880bb1e48ee2b91d803b08f162cefee:1
  • value  403940794
    address  32oTsn2wvtZUqZxmvRirT4Q5suTXjVWHUR